What to expect
Milford Sound is a renowned fjord in Fiordland National Park, celebrated for its dramatic cliffs, cascading waterfalls, and unique wildlife. This day trip offers a seamless itinerary from Queenstown, combining guided nature walks, scenic viewpoints, and a cruise through the heart of the fjord.
Features
-
Guided nature walks: Explore select trails with your guide, who shares insights into the region’s native flora and geological history.
-
Scenic stops en route: Pause at handpicked viewpoints for photo opportunities and to appreciate the changing landscapes of Fiordland.
-
Milford Sound cruise: Board a comfortable vessel for a cruise past iconic features like Mitre Peak and Stirling Falls, with live commentary on local wildlife and natural wonders.
-
Return transfers: Enjoy hassle-free travel to and from Queenstown, allowing you to relax and focus on the journey.
